DRK now has to manage Darkside uptime via two skills that become free when TBN breaks (costs 1/3rd of your mana otherwise) and seems it is getting a damage window.
PLD has its Sword Oath stacks.
GNB has to manage it's Continuation combos via its ammos.
DPS rotations for tanks are getting at least a bit more involved across the board.
